Official : Agbontohoma extends contract with Sheffield Wednesday
Published: July 20, 2022
Through their official website, League One club Sheffield Wednesday have announced that former Arsenal schoolboy David Agbontohoma has extended his contract with the Owls.
The 20-year-old arrived at Sheffield Wednesday a year ago following a successful trial.
He made his professional debut against against Harrogate Town in the EFL Trophy on November 9, 2021 and was also handed game time against Hartlepool in the same competition last season.
Agbontohoma was a reserve option in a League One clash against Doncaster Rovers back in February.
Sheffield Wednesday higher-ups are pleased with his development and have offered him fresh terms.
Speaking on his new deal, Agbontohoma said : "I am delighted to get this done with the season ahead, and now I want to work towards getting in the first team.
"Ever since I first came on trial, I found the club very welcoming.
"The gaffer handed me my debut last season which was a good experience and I’m just trying to kick on from there.
"This season I’m going to get my head down and try to build up some more appearances."
Apart from the Gunners, Agbontohoma has also played for the youth teams of Chelsea and Southampton.
